From your description it seems like a masticatory muscle spasm. Generally heals by itself if you give it rest.
For few days:-
Take soft diet. Don't chew anything hard.
Don't press on the site to check for pain.
While yawning try to support your lower jaw with your palm to avoid stretching of the muscle.
Next Steps
If there is no change in a week please consult your dentist for further investigation to rule out any jaw joint problem, nerve issues or any unusual swelling/ growth.
